Official Description

Dissociative and conversion disorders

Metadata & Insights
  • 2026 ICD-10-CM Edition - Effective October 1, 2025.
  • Non-billable category (requires more specific sub-code).
  • Chapter 5: Mental, Behavioral and Neurodevelopmental Disorders (F01-F99).

Instructional Notes

Includes
  • conversion hysteria
  • conversion reaction
  • hysteria
  • hysterical psychosis
Excludes2(Not included here)
  • malingering [conscious simulation] (Z76.5)

Clinical Hierarchy

CH5Mental, Behavioral and Neurodevelopmental disorders (F01-F99)
F40-F48Anxiety, dissociative, stress-related, somatoform and other nonpsychotic mental disorders (F40-F48)
F44Dissociative and conversion disorders
F44.0Dissociative amnesia
F44.1Dissociative fugue
F44.2Dissociative stupor
F44.4Conversion disorder with motor symptom or deficit
F44.5Conversion disorder with seizures or convulsions
F44.6Conversion disorder with sensory symptom or deficit
F44.7Conversion disorder with mixed symptom presentation
F44.8Other dissociative and conversion disorders
F44.9Dissociative and conversion disorder, unspecified
